This striking image captures Edward Coke, the renowned English jurist and Baronet of Holkham, in the prime of his life. Born in 1552, Coke rose to prominence during the early modern period as a leading figure in the legal world. He is depicted here in his full regalia, wearing a ruff collar, a white doublet, and a chain signifying his high social status. The ermine-trimmed hat atop his head is a symbol of his noble title as a Lord. Coke's legal career began in the late 16th century, and he quickly gained a reputation for his expertise in interpreting common law. He served as Solicitor General under Queen Elizabeth I and later became Attorney General under King James I. Coke's most significant contribution to English law came in the form of his Institutes of the Laws of England, a comprehensive work that helped establish the principles of common law and the role of the judiciary.
